How they compare

Japan currently reports 18.9% against 18.6% in Colombia, a difference of 0.3%.

Across all 11 years both countries report, Japan has been ahead every year.

Colombia ranks 14th and Japan ranks 12th of 144 countries.

Japan has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Colombia Japan Difference Ahead
1960s 1.2% 2.5% 1.3% Japan
1970s 2.1% 4.6% 2.5% Japan
1980s 4.8% 7.9% 3.1% Japan
1990s 8.0% 13.4% 5.4% Japan
2000s 7.6% 17.0% 9.4% Japan
2010s 18.6% 18.9% 0.4% Japan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
